Player Story

George Lea story

George Lea built his college career from 2016 through 2019 as a defensive lineman from New Orleans, LA wearing No. 17, spending time with Arizona State. The clearest part of George Lea's career was his defensive production: 68 tackles, 12.5 tackles for loss, and 4 sacks across 28 career games in the available record.
